E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ures Tintoretto's masterpiece, "Christ and the adulteress" painted between 1545-48. The oil on canvas artwork measures 119 x 168 cm and is housed in the Palazzo Corsini, Gallerie Nazionali Barberini Corsini in Rome, Italy. Stefano Baldini expertly photographs this iconic piece from the National Gallery of Ancient Art. The painting depicts a powerful scene from biblical times, illustrating Christ's encounter with an adulterous woman. Tintoretto skillfully portrays Jesus as he confronts a group of religious leaders who are preparing to stone the woman for her sins. With his compassionate gaze and outstretched hand, Christ offers forgiveness and mercy instead of condemnation. The vibrant colors and intricate details showcased in this image highlight Tintoretto's mastery as an artist during the Renaissance period. The composition draws viewers into the emotional intensity of the moment while emphasizing themes of redemption and grace.
